TNT Drama will broadcast the 67th episode of AEW Dynamite a New Year’s Smash special, on January 6 today live from the Daily’s Place in Jacksonville Florida. This week’s episode features two title defenses as Kenny Omega will play the AEW World Championship against Rey Fenix and Abadon will challenge Hikaru Shida for the AEW Women’s World Championship

The Young Bucks (Matt and Nick Jackson) and SCU (Christopher Daniels and Frankie Kazarian) vs.

The Acclaimed (Anthony Bowens and Max Caster) and The Hybrid 2 Angelico and Jack Evans
Daniels tries the Arabian Moonsault in the opening bars but is stopped by Bowens. Evans Springboard Double Knee Drop for the count of two Bowens tries a Lariat and Daniels welcomes him in a Blue Thunder Bomb. German Suplex with Kazarian bridge over Evans for the count of two Nick clears ringside with two Spins Stoppers a Spear and a Diving Crossbody. Kazarian’s DDT slingshot to Bowens, a combination of BTE Trigger and knee to the back of the head on Bowens but Evans stops the count of three. Nick greets Evans with his knees up in a 450 Splash the Bucks Superkick Party against all of their opponents, and Springboard Swanton Bomb to ringside on The Acclaimed. Best Meltzer Driver Ever and victory.

Winners: The Young Bucks (Matt and Nick Jackson) and SCU (Christopher Daniels and Frankie Kazarian) via pinfall.

Frankie Kazarian recalls that the challenge that he proposed to Christopher Daniels at the end of 2020 is still valid, consisting in that they must separate as a team if they suffer one more defeat. Christopher Daniels says that will never happen and that the Young Bucks will always have their backs until the night they meet for the AEW World Tag Team Championships.

Jake Hager vs. Wardlow

MJF Sammy Guevara Santana and OrtizThey are at ringside. Slow start until they both knock out each other with Lariats at ringside. Wardlow with a Chop Block in the corner, Spinebuster and applies a series of Vertical Release Suplexes for the count of two. Hager recovers with a Lariat and tries a Vader Bomb which Wardlow tries to receive with his knees up but Hager notices in time and opts for the Ankle Lock. Wardlow escapes by throwing Hager badly against the ringside barricades Release German Suplex and Swanton Bomb but when Wardlow looks for the count of three Hager surprises with a Triangle. Wardlow escapes, Hager climbs him to the third rope and chokes him again with the Triangle until his rival throws him face-to-face against the top corner. F10 and victory.
Winner: Wardlow via pinfall.

Jake Hager is very angry about the result, although he fists Wardlow after the fight.

Tony Schiavone is in the ring to lead the official weigh-in for Darby Allin and Brian Cage heading into the TNT Championship match that will take place at Dynamite next week. Brian Cage accompanied by Taz Ricky Starks Powerhouse Hobbs and Hook is the first to step on the scale and he weighs 102 kilos. Darby next confirms a weight of 77 kilos and Taz says it is not fair since he weighs more than he should because he is wearing a jacket, chains, and an iron belt. Allin takes the mic says he’s tired of dealing with people like Taz and tries to attack them but before he can do anything the lights go out. Sting makes an appearance with the bat in hand to bring order, but not before maintaining a tense face to face with the champion.
